labview模拟电梯、labview串口助手、labview自动售货机、labview计算器.zip
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
LabVIEW,全称为Laboratory Virtual Instrument Engineering Workbench(实验室虚拟仪器工程工作台),是一款由美国国家仪器(NI)公司开发的图形化编程环境,广泛应用于数据采集、测试测量、控制系统设计等多个领域。在这个压缩包中,包含四个LabVIEW项目:模拟电梯、串口助手、自动售货机和计算器。接下来,我们将深入探讨这些知识点。 1. **LabVIEW模拟电梯**: 在这个项目中,LabVIEW被用来模拟实际电梯的运行逻辑。用户可以通过虚拟界面控制电梯的上行、下行、开门、关门等操作。这个项目涉及到的主要知识点有: - **事件结构**:LabVIEW中的事件结构用于处理不同类型的用户交互或系统事件。 - **定时器和计数器**:用于模拟电梯的运行时间和楼层计数。 - **状态机设计**:电梯运行的各种状态(如等待、上升、下降、开门、关门等)可以通过状态机模型实现。 - **数据通信**:模拟电梯多层间的信号传递,例如楼层选择信号。 2. **LabVIEW串口助手**: 串口助手是测试和调试设备时常用的一个工具,用于发送和接收串行数据。在LabVIEW中实现串口助手涉及以下技术: - **串口通信**:理解串行端口的工作原理,如波特率、数据位、停止位和校验位设置。 - **字符串操作**:发送和接收的数据通常以字符串形式处理。 - **实时数据显示**:通过虚拟仪表或文本框实时显示接收到的数据。 - **用户界面设计**:创建友好的交互界面,包括输入框、发送按钮和接收数据显示区。 3. **LabVIEW自动售货机**: 这个项目展示了如何用LabVIEW构建一个简单的自动售货机模型,可能涉及: - **控制逻辑**:根据投入的硬币数量和商品价格进行计算。 - **I/O交互**:模拟硬币投入和商品出货的动作。 - **数值计算和比较**:验证投入的金额是否足够购买商品。 - **条件结构**:根据不同的输入和库存情况执行相应的操作。 - **显示功能**:显示剩余商品数量、投入金额和找零信息。 4. **LabVIEW计算器**: LabVIEW计算器项目是实现基本算术运算的工具,如加减乘除。主要知识点: - **数学函数**:使用LabVIEW内置的数学函数来执行运算。 - **用户界面设计**:创建数字键盘和操作按钮,以及结果显示区域。 - **数据类型转换**:将用户输入的字符串转换为数值进行计算。 - **错误处理**:考虑非法输入和除以零等错误情况。 通过以上四个项目,学习者可以深入理解LabVIEW的基本编程概念、图形化编程的思维方式以及如何利用其进行实际应用开发。无论是对于初学者还是有经验的工程师,这些项目都是很好的学习和实践资源,有助于提升在LabVIEW环境下的编程技能。
- 1
- xuewenbo1232022-10-31感谢资源主的分享,很值得参考学习,资源价值较高,支持!
- NH29781954272023-07-20资源内容详细全面,与描述一致,对我很有用,有一定的使用价值。
- 2301_772167752024-01-03资源是宝藏资源,实用也是真的实用,感谢大佬分享~
- 粉丝: 333
- 资源: 2100
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助